WebWhen are therapeutic injections recommended to treat knee arthritis pain? It depends on several factors, such as treatment goals and what is causing the knee pain. Cortisone, hyaluronic acid, platelet rich plasma (PRP), and stem cell injections, as well as prolotherapy can all be used to treat knee osteoarthritis.
